JugPython 并行處理框架
Jug 是一個(gè)基于任務(wù)的并行處理框架,采用 Python 編寫,可用來在不同的機(jī)器上運(yùn)行同一個(gè)任務(wù),使用 NFS 做文件系統(tǒng)的通訊。
示例代碼:
from jug import TaskGenerator
from time import sleep
@TaskGenerator
def is_prime(n):
sleep(1.)
for j in xrange(2,n-1):
if (n % j) == 0:
return False
return True
primes100 = map(is_prime, xrange(2,101))
評(píng)論
圖片
表情
